Best 45030 Ohio Public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 6 public schools serving 4,340 students in 45030, OH (there are 5 private schools, serving 390 private students). 91% of all K-12 students in 45030, OH are educated in public schools (compared to the OH state average of 88%).
The top-ranked public schools in 45030, OH are Crosby Elementary School, Miami Whitewater Elementary School and Harrison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 45030 have an average math proficiency score of 67% (versus the Ohio public school average of 55%), and reading proficiency score of 68% (versus the 60% statewide average). Schools in 45030, OH have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Ohio public schools.
Minority enrollment is 10%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public school average of 35% (majority Black).
